    The Dorco blades in the blue/gray/white pack are ST300's. The ones in the red/white pack are ST301's. The general consensus is that the ST300's are awful and the ST301's are decent. From personal use I agree with that assessment. However, blades are the most personal of likes and dislikes in shaving gear. Definitely try all the blades before making up your mind.
